He has an LS tranny. With the cost of the actual LSD, plus the cost of the FD ring gear, and 4.400 countershaft, it will cost too much for him because....

<TABLE WIDTH="90%" CELLSPACING=0 CELLPADDING=0 ALIGN=CENTER><TR><TD>Quote, originally posted by 95rippinrs &raquo;</TD></TR><TR><TD CLASS="quote">I dont have that much money</TD></TR></TABLE>



I'd would say to go for the OBX LSD. I have heard good things about them. But just today, I started seeing threads saying they're bad. I dunno, try doing some research on them and see what you find. $300-350, almost exactly like Quaiffe, and a lifetime warranty.
